    Default Granpappy's German Map Case

    I was celebrating Independence Day at my dear old Aunties. She said "I got something for ya" and pulled out this sweet German map case which belonged to my grandfather. There was a long leather wallet in it which had his notebook with some German words translated, and some addresses of other family members who were in the War, including my Great Uncle Milt who was killed in the Pacific Theatre.
